Baht level 'appropriate'

The current level of the baht is appropriate for Thailand's exports and imports as well as overal economic conditions, the Bank of Thailand (BOT) chief pronounced yesterday.
The comments by MR Pridiyathorn Devakula, governor of the central bank, were in reaction to a statement made by Finance Minister Thanong Bidaya on Tuesday that a suitable baht value would be between Bt39.50 and Bt40.50 per US dollar.The baht had appreciated against the dollar to Bt38.65 by March 2, from Bt41 at the end of last year. However, the baht has depreciated against the dollar over the past two days due to the BOT's intervention as well as the dollar's appreciation due to stronger US economic indicators, dealers said. The Thai unit opened yesterday at Bt38.87 to Bt38.90 and closed at Bt38.98 to Bt39.01. "The current baht level is suitable for our economy and exports. It is not necessary that opinions over the baht value be the same. "I think the exchange rate is suitable right now," Pridiyathorn said. The central bank's governor admitted the bank had "overseen" the baht level on Monday and left the currency market untouched on Tuesday. Anoma Srisukkasem, Somruedi BanchongduangThe Nation
